Wayne "Gil" West is an American businessman, and the CEO of Hertz Global Holdings since April 2024.

West earned a bachelor's degree in mechanical engineering from North Carolina State University in 1984, aand an MBA from National University in 1990.[1]

West was chief operating officer (COO) of Delta Airlines from March 2014 to October 2020.[1][2] He was COO of General Motors' self-driving cars Cruise division from January 2021 to December 2023.[1][2]

On 15 March 2024, it was announced that West would succeed Stephen Scherr as CEO of Hertz on 1 April 2024.[2]
